Accountant Salary in New Zealand
Median pay for a Accountant in New Zealand stands at NZ$110,000 per year, equivalent to about $62,644. That is 79% of the US median for the same role, and career progression can lift earnings from NZ$74,700 at entry level to NZ$152,000 with seniority.
Compared with the 62 countries we track, New Zealand pays this role close to the global midpoint. Within East Asia & Pacific, pay for this role in New Zealand is broadly in line with neighbouring markets.
Accountant Salary Table
| Experience | 25th % | Median | 75th % | 90th % |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Entry Level (0-2 years) | NZ$62,700 | NZ$74,700 | NZ$90,300 | NZ$108,000 |
| Mid Level (3-5 years) | NZ$92,200 | NZ$110,000 | NZ$133,000 | NZ$159,000 |
| Senior (6-10 years) | NZ$127,000 | NZ$152,000 | NZ$183,000 | NZ$220,000 |
| Lead / Staff (10+ years) | NZ$159,000 | NZ$189,000 | NZ$229,000 | NZ$274,000 |
| Executive / Director | NZ$208,000 | NZ$247,000 | NZ$299,000 | NZ$358,000 |

How Much Does a Accountant Earn in New Zealand?
The middle 50% of accountants in New Zealand earn between NZ$92,200 and NZ$133,000 a year, with the median at NZ$110,000. Where you fall in that range depends mostly on three things: years of experience, employer type, and specialization. This is largely location-bound work, so local market conditions and the strength of New Zealand's economy set the ceiling more than international rates do.
New Zealand vs the World
Converted to US dollars, the median accountant salary in New Zealand is $62,644 — 79% of what the same role pays in the United States ($79,000). The highest-paying countries we track for this role are Singapore ($133,072), Ireland ($121,094), Qatar ($116,209). Keep in mind that higher-paying markets usually pair with higher living costs, so net purchasing power gaps are smaller than the headline numbers.
From Entry Level to Senior: What Changes
Experience pays in this field: entry-level roles average NZ$74,700, mid-career professionals earn a median of NZ$110,000, and senior specialists reach NZ$152,000+. That is a 2.0x span from first job to senior level. In New Zealand, the biggest single jumps typically come from switching employers rather than internal raises — a pattern consistent across most markets we track.
Hiring Demand and Job Security
Demand for accountants in New Zealand is solid, scoring 76/100 on our demand index. About 60% of positions in this field can be performed remotely or in hybrid arrangements, which widens the effective job market for candidates in New Zealand beyond national borders. For job seekers this tilts negotiating leverage toward candidates: multiple offers are realistic, and counter-offers are common.
Inflation and Real Earnings
Inflation in New Zealand is a modest 2.8%, so nominal salary figures translate fairly directly into stable purchasing power. Raises above 2.8% represent genuine real-terms gains.
Required Skills and Education
Most employers expect bachelor's degree in accounting; cpa often preferred. Day to day, the skills that consistently correlate with higher pay in this field are financial reporting, tax preparation, gaap/ifrs — and, at senior levels, excel and reconciliation. Candidates who can demonstrate these with concrete work examples routinely land in the upper half of the salary range.
